2025-26 Sky Bet Championship: Week 15 – Saturday

Middlesbrough host Birmingham City in a massive Sky Bet Championship clash. 

Victory will lift Middlesbrough up to second if Stoke fail to beat Coventry at home, whilst Birmingham can climb to sixth with a win if results elsewhere go in their favour.

 

Team News

Alfie Jones is suspended for Middlesbrough following his red card in their 1-1 draw at Leicester.

George Edmundson (hamstring), Abdoulaye Kante (hernia/groin), Seny Dieng and Darragh Lenihan (both Achilles) remain ruled out.

Birmingham have no fresh injury concerns to report after beating Millwall 4-0 on Tuesday night.

Ethan Laird (hamstring) and Willum Willumsson (unspecified) remain absent.

 

When is Kick-Off?

Middlesbrough host Birmingham City on Saturday 8 November at the Riverside Stadium in a 3pm GMT kick-off, untelevised live in the UK.

Prediction

With uncertainty surrounding the future of Rob Edwards and two underwhelming away performances in the last week, Boro now need to deliver a performance that gives their boss reason to stay and lead them to potential promotion with improved clinical finishing.

Birmingham meanwhile have won just one of their last six away games but come into this game off the back of a ruthless 4-0 demolition of Millwall, which will do their confidence some good and they also have no distractions off the pitch so I expect them to be focused here.

Boro however are yet to lose at home but on current form, I can see them grinding out a draw because Birmingham do seem to be finding some form in their last four games.

Prediction: Middlesbrough 1-1 Birmingham City

Result: Middlesbrough 2-1 Birmingham City
